26V, Zero-Drift, High-Precision Current Monitors, ZXCT214 Replace MCP6C02.
FEATURES

• Supply Voltage Range: 2.7V to 26V

• Temperature Range: -40°C to +125°C
• Wide Common-Mode Range: -0.3V to 26V
• Support Shunt Drops of 10mV Full-Scale
• Gain Error (Maximum Overtemperature)
  • A and B Version: ±0.8%
  • C Version: ±0.5%
• Low Offset Voltage: ±30μV (max)
• Quiescent Current: 100μA (max)
• Low Gain Error Drift: 10ppm/°C (max)
• Rail-to-Rail Output Capacity
• Choice of Gains:
  – ZXCT210: 200V/V
  – ZXCT211: 500V/V
  – ZXCT212: 1000V/V
  – ZXCT213: 50V/V
  – ZXCT214: 100V/V
  – ZXCT215: 75V/V
• Package: 6-pin SOT363 and 10-pin U-QFN1418-10
• Totally Lead-Free & Fully RoHS Compliant (Notes 1 & 2)
• Halogen and Antimony Free. “Green” Device (Note 3)
• An automotive-compliant part is available under separate

  datasheet (ZXCT21xQ)

FEATURES

• Single Amplifier: MCP6C02

• Bidirectional or Unidirectional
• Input (Common-mode) Voltages:
  - +3.0V to +65V, specified
  - +2.8V to +68V, operating
  - -0.3V to +70V, survival
• Power Supply:
  - 2.0V to 5.5V
  - Single or Dual (Split) Supplies
• High DC Precision:
  - VOS: ±1.65 μV (typical)
  - CMRR: 154 dB (typical)
  - PSRR: 138 dB (typical)
  - Gain Error: ±0.1% (typical)
• Preset Gains: 20, 50 and 100 V/V
• POR Protection:
  - HV POR for VIP – VSS
  - LV POR for VDD – VSS
• Bandwidth: 500 kHz (typical)
• Supply Currents:
  - IDD: 490 μA (typical)
  - IBP: 170 μA (typical)
• Enhanced EMI Protection:
  - EMIRR: 118 dB at 2.4 GHz (typical)
• Specified Temperature Ranges:
  - -40°C to +125°C (E-Temp part)
  - -40°C to +150°C (H-Temp part)
